nginx中amh修改ftp默认端口的方法

看博文发表日期,我已经有3个月没有更新博客.因wordpress自动升级失败,拖了数日,后来找小张帮我手动恢复了博客程序和数据库.过后数日,小张将我的虚拟空间转入vps,其后又过了若干天,我将日志附件上传至服务器.某一天我想更换个主题,发现ftp总是无法上传.期间小张数次帮我测试,carl也帮我测试,他俩总是可以正常连接.前日深夜,我又同小张讨论这个问题,无果.突然想到isp封杀80端口,那么21端口也可能.于是尝试修改ftp端口,居然解决问题!一句脏话喷薄而出.

vps安装的为AMH虚拟主机面板.修改ftp端口步骤如下:

 代码如下 复制代码

#登录到SSH

#vi打开配置文件

vi /etc/pure-ftpd.conf

#按insert,插入绑定端口配置
       Bind,210
:wq,保存并退出vi

#重启FTPwww.111cn.net

/usr/local/sbin/redhat.init restart
 
#配置iptables,增加新端口211

vi /etc/amh-iptables

#插入
-A INPUT -p tcp -m tcp –dport 211 -j ACCEPT

#执行

/sbin/iptables-restore < /etc/amh-iptables

时间: 2024-11-03 19:36:37

nginx中amh修改ftp默认端口的方法的相关文章

linux中vps修改ssh默认端口方法

修改linux vps ssh 22端口 解除ssh爆破烦恼,查看日志会发现有很多 linux下登录日志在下面的目录里: cd /var/log 查看ssh用户的登录日志: less secure linux日志管理 如果显现很多外地ip登录失败 那就是被恶意爆破了 穷举法,或称为暴力破解法,是一种针对于密码的破译方法,即将密码进行逐个推算直到找出真正的密码为止.例如一个已知是四位并且全部由数字组成的密码,其可能共有10000种组合,因此最多尝试10000次就能找到正确的密码.理论上利用这种方法

Windows server 2008 r2的本地默认端口禁用方法

  win server 2008 r2的默认端口禁用方法. 通过命令"netstat -an"可以知道系统当前监听的端口.在Windows server 2008系统上,有两种途经可以禁用本地端口:1.通过Windows防火墙(比较简单,设置方便).2.通过IP安全策略(比较复杂,功能强大,不依赖防火墙).小编下面介绍的是第一种方法,简单设置即可完成. 一.通过Windows防火墙禁用端口: 1.点击 "控制面板-Windows防火墙",确保启用了Windows防

xp纯净版系统修改命令提示符默认位置的方法

xp纯净版系统修改命令提示符默认位置的方法   具体如下: 1.在Windows XP中,单击"开始→所有程序→附件→命令提示符",即可打开命令提示符窗口,默认情况下系统会定位到"X:Documents and Settings当前用户名>"下,其中X为操作系统所在盘符.但一般来说,我们用到命令提示符时需要在特定的目录下工作,因此有必要使用"计算机管理"功能来更改命令提示符的默认位置. 2.单击"开始→控制面板→性能和维护→管理工

xampp修改mysql默认密码的方法_Mysql

在这里介绍xampp修改mysql默认密码的大概过程是先利用xampp的phpmyadmin进入修改mysql密码,修改之后我们再修改xampp中phpmyadmin的密码,这样就完整的修改mysql默认密码了. 大概过程 在mysql里设密码打开IE输入网址localhostphpadmin之后,点用户看到有root用户,往下拉,找到修改密码的地方,输入密码,进行执行操作,最后再去到在你的xampp安装目录下找到phpadmin文件夹,打开找到config.inc.php文件之后,打开找关于m

linux修改ssh默认端口方法详解

第一种: 01假如要改Linux SSH的默认端口(22),那么你只要修改:/etc/ssh/sshd_config中Port 22,这里把22改成自己要设的端口就行了,不过千万别设和现已有的端口相同哦,以防造成未知后果. 02假如要限制SSH登陆的IP,那么可以如下做: 先:修改/etc/hosts.deny,在其中加入sshd:ALL 然后:修改:/etc/hosts.allow,在其中进行如下设置:sshd:192.168.0.241 这样就可以限制只有192.168.0.241的IP通过

Linux更新Python版本及修改python默认版本的方法_linux shell

linux下更新Python版本并修改默认版本,有需要的朋友可以参考下. 很多情况下拿到的服务器python版本很低,需要自己动手更改默认python版本 1.从官网下载python安装包(这个版本可以是任意版本3.3 2.7 2.6等等) wget http://python.org/ftp/python/2.7/Python-2.7.tar.bz2   2.解压并安装 tar -jxvf Python-2.7.tar.bz2 cd Python-3.3.0 ./configure make

linux中CentOS 5.5 下修改Apache默认端口80

打开 /etc/httpd/conf/httpd.conf 文件 修改两个地方  代码如下 复制代码 #Listen 12.34.56.78:80 Listen 80 #把80改为你设置的端口,我设置端口为8080  代码如下 复制代码 Listen 8080 NameVirtualHost *:80 #把80改为你设置的端口,我设置端口为8080  代码如下 复制代码 NameVirtualHost *:8080 保存修改,退出.  代码如下 复制代码 semanage port -a -t

修改Apache默认端口

有些时候在安装了AppServ之后会有Apache无法打开的问题,主要原因是默认的80端口被占用,修改方法如下: 1.在安装目录,如C:\AppServ\Apache2.2\conf下找到文件httpd.conf 2.在文件中搜索"Listen 80"并将其替换为"Listen XXXX",其中XXXX为新的端口号 3,关闭并重启Apache 测试结果,在浏览器中输入http://localhost:XXXX可以出来如下界面:

centos下修改ssh默认端口的步骤详解

第一.修改S S H端口 VPS默认的S S H端口是22,为防止MJJ们扫描端口破解密码,修改ssh端口为其他的数字,是非常有必要的. 好了,SSH登陆VPS,修改配置文件. vi /etc/ssh/sshd_config 找到#Port 22,去掉前面的#,并修改为Port 1520(数字尽量用4位数,避免被占用),然后重启就可生效. CentOS 重启SSH : service sshd restart Debian重启SSH:service ssh restart 第二.禁止ROOT账户